Reliance 45C204A (45C-204-A)

The 45C204A, also marked as 45C-204-A, is a failsafe and redundancy processor module designed for Reliance AutoMate 30, 40 and 45C series PLC systems. It serves as a backup control unit to monitor the operating status of the main CPU and realize seamless switchover in case of main unit faults, so as to keep critical industrial equipment running continuously. This model is an upgraded hardware revision of the original 45C204, with optimized internal circuits and enhanced operational stability. The product has been discontinued, and only surplus, refurbished or new old stock units are available for maintenance and replacement of legacy automation systems.

Model Number Interpretation

45C is the unified prefix for all modules of the Reliance AutoMate PLC series. 204 represents the dedicated failsafe and redundancy processor module. The hyphen is a common writing style for part numbers in the industrial field. The letter A indicates the first hardware revision with improved component performance and stronger fault tolerance.

Technical Specifications

The module is powered by 24VDC supplied through the system backplane. It is equipped with one DB9 interface for RS-232 communication and a dedicated port for redundancy connection. Eight LED indicators on the front panel display the status of readiness, data transmission, data reception, normal communication and communication errors. Two adjustable dials are used to set network node addresses. The operating temperature ranges from 0°C to 55°C. It can be installed on DIN rails or mounting panels, occupying a single slot of the rack. It adopts a sturdy metal enclosure, and the total weight is approximately 1.0 kilogram.

Interface and Communication Configuration

It connects to the main CPU and other functional modules of AutoMate 30, 40 and 45C series via a proprietary backplane bus. The RS-232 interface is used for serial data interaction with external devices. The exclusive redundancy link port is applied to establish a backup connection with the main control unit. This module has no independent programming port, and all parameter settings and function configuration need to be completed through the matched main CPU. It cannot be used together with backplanes and modules of AutoMate 20 series.

Core Functions

It works as a backup processor to monitor the real-time running state of the main CPU all the time. It performs bumpless failover automatically once the main CPU breaks down, effectively avoiding system shutdown. It manages redundant communication links and conducts real-time fault diagnosis for the whole control system. It shares part of the data processing work to reduce the load of the main CPU. The upgraded design of revision A further improves stability and anti-interference ability in harsh industrial environments.

Application Scenarios

It is mainly applied to critical production lines and process control sites that require high operational reliability and low downtime. It is widely used in energy, chemical, pharmaceutical and other industrial fields with strict safety requirements. It is suitable for large-scale distributed control systems built on AutoMate 30, 40 and 45C series PLCs. It acts as a direct replacement for the old 45C204 module in aging legacy equipment.

Usage and Maintenance Instructions

Install the module firmly into the rack slot and ensure the backplane connector is fully locked in place. Set the unique node address via the dials before powering on the system and prevent address conflict. Check all connecting cables and communication lines regularly to guarantee stable connection. Carry out quarterly routine inspections to observe LED status, check cable tightness and clean dust on the module surface for good heat dissipation. Cut off the total power supply and wait for sufficient discharge before disassembly or maintenance to prevent electric shock. Only use supporting accessories and modules of AutoMate 30, 40 and 45C series for assembly and replacement.
